HScrollBar
|
|
==========
|
|
|
|
**Inherits:** :ref:`ScrollBar<class_ScrollBar>` **<** :ref:`Range<class_Range>` **<** :ref:`Control<class_Control>` **<** :ref:`CanvasItem<class_CanvasItem>` **<** :ref:`Node<class_Node>` **<** :ref:`Object<class_Object>`
|
|
|
|
A horizontal scrollbar that goes from left (min) to right (max).
|
|
|
|
.. rst-class:: classref-introduction-group
|
|
|
|
Description
|
|
-----------
|
|
|
|
A horizontal scrollbar, typically used to navigate through content that extends beyond the visible width of a control. It is a :ref:`Range<class_Range>`-based control and goes from left (min) to right (max).

Theme Property Descriptions
|
|
---------------------------
|
|
|
|
.. _class_HScrollBar_theme_constant_padding_bottom:
|
|
|
|
.. rst-class:: classref-themeproperty
|
|
|
|
:ref:`int<class_int>` **padding_bottom** = ``0`` :ref:`🔗<class_HScrollBar_theme_constant_padding_bottom>`
|
|
|
|
Padding between the bottom of the :ref:`ScrollBar.scroll<class_ScrollBar_theme_style_scroll>` element and the :ref:`ScrollBar.grabber<class_ScrollBar_theme_style_grabber>`.
|
|
|
|
\ **Note:** To apply horizontal padding, modify the left/right content margins of :ref:`ScrollBar.scroll<class_ScrollBar_theme_style_scroll>` instead.
|
|
|
|
.. rst-class:: classref-item-separator
|
|
|
|
----
|
|
|
|
.. _class_HScrollBar_theme_constant_padding_top:
|
|
|
|
.. rst-class:: classref-themeproperty
|
|
|
|
:ref:`int<class_int>` **padding_top** = ``0`` :ref:`🔗<class_HScrollBar_theme_constant_padding_top>`
|
|
|
|
Padding between the top of the :ref:`ScrollBar.scroll<class_ScrollBar_theme_style_scroll>` element and the :ref:`ScrollBar.grabber<class_ScrollBar_theme_style_grabber>`.
|
|
|
|
\ **Note:** To apply horizontal padding, modify the left/right content margins of :ref:`ScrollBar.scroll<class_ScrollBar_theme_style_scroll>` instead.
